Transaction 73d63b2f646a5e513e346730f3f1e42706c00e5cb625c412a05702f9154a1285
1 Input
2 Outputs
- 73d63b2f646a5e513e346730f3f1e42706c00e5cb625c412a05702f9154a1285:0
- 73d63b2f646a5e513e346730f3f1e42706c00e5cb625c412a05702f9154a1285:1
value 6103545
address 19rfXPoqcjxBYHLH2G3L5hXhSyLRU74XuL
value 9007494
address 3PBuyNMvKhRZRE5PfGNdtkLn21xn9CzcGM